In this Industry Report
The iPhone has had a significant impact on the mobile games industry. It has boosted the demand for mobile content and opened the market to smaller publishers, presenting a challenge to the big players. While the big three mobile games publishers, EA Mobile, Gameloft and Glu Mobile all saw revenues grow in 2008, Screen Digest believes that their market share experienced a slight decline. New platforms such as the iPhone, along with Nokia's N-Gage and Google's Android mobile operating system are expected to be key drivers of growth in 2009.
This quarterly report combines Mobile Media Intelligence data and analyst commentary covering publishers' financial results, new title releases, mobile games market revenues and forecasts in areas covered by Screen Digest Mobile Media Intelligence: Europe, North America, Japan, South Korea, India and China.
Highlights: - EA Mobile remains the top publisher with record $48m Q4 revenues and is on track to reach its fiscal 2009 revenue target.
- Glu Mobile predicts a 15% decline for its 2009 revenues.
- A strong lineup of games for the iPhone helped Gameloft close the gap with EA Mobile.
- Growth slows in Western markets for Gameloft and Glu Mobile.
- Games on the iPhone grabbed 12% market share in North America in Q4 2008.
- Q4 2008 releases shows a stronger trend towards casual titles
